diff options
| author | Aldrik Ramaekers <aldrik.ramaekers@protonmail.com> | 2020-03-15 11:58:58 +0100 |
|---|---|---|
| committer | Aldrik Ramaekers <aldrik.ramaekers@protonmail.com> | 2020-03-15 11:58:58 +0100 |
| commit | 0be4f86dcd85f6a91bfaa7b600da4b916ad4f432 (patch) | |
| tree | f1d3b5cc629ad8baa62ed887e634fa2db2b72d67 /src | |
| parent | d4c5a35005f4e1d69bbe0a8fc013e94e8122093b (diff) | |
work
Diffstat (limited to 'src')
| -rw-r--r-- | src/mo_edit.c | 2 | ||||
| -rw-r--r-- | src/save.c | 3 |
2 files changed, 4 insertions, 1 deletions
diff --git a/src/mo_edit.c b/src/mo_edit.c index 9b954b4..d0215d7 100644 --- a/src/mo_edit.c +++ b/src/mo_edit.c @@ -10,6 +10,8 @@ s32 global_language_id = 1;
char project_path[MAX_INPUT_LENGTH];
+// TODO(Aldrik): show current loaded project path somewhere (maybe title?)
+
typedef struct t_language
{
char *name;
@@ -193,6 +193,8 @@ bool read_mo_file(char *buffer, s32 buffer_size, s32 language_id) void load_project_from_folder(char *path_buf) { + string_copyn(project_path, path_buf, MAX_INPUT_LENGTH); + if (!platform_directory_exists(path_buf)) { platform_show_message(main_window, localize("error_loading_project"), localize("project_directory_does_not_exist")); @@ -277,7 +279,6 @@ static void* load_project_d(void *arg) if (string_equals(path_buf, "")) return 0; if (!platform_directory_exists(path_buf)) return 0; - string_copyn(project_path, path_buf, MAX_INPUT_LENGTH); load_project_from_folder(path_buf); return 0; } |
